What's been happening

Firstly, thanks to everyone who turned out for the AGM. For those who missed it the headlines were:

  • We agreed to cut the membership fee to £5 for 2010 as we don't need the cash.
  • The existing committee was re-elected with the exception of Dryd who didn't stand.
  • In an impromptu vote of thanks for all his work Andy Dibble was voted on to the committee. I think his official title is "beginners representative". Nice one Andy.
  • We agreed a general spending plan for the rest of the year.
  • That plan included £100 to buy new titles for the club library. Ric has already ordered "The Drifter", "The Present" and the "110%" dvds.
  • The policy of trying to subsidise all club events will be dropped for 2010 but some events may get a subsidy if there is spare cash in the pot.

So, we're legit for another 12 months. Good job folks.

The following week we ran the ISA competition judging course, courtesy of Mark Parry from the BSA. We had 8 bodies (after a few late cancellations) and everyone passed so congratulations to all concerned and thanks to Mark for trekking up from Plymouth to run the course.
